Quick Answer: What Is Snowflake Data Model?

What type of database is snowflake?

SQL databaseSnowflake is fundamentally built to be a complete SQL database.

It is a columnar-stored relational database and works well with Tableau, Excel and many other tools familiar to end users..

Is Snowflake OLAP or OLTP?

Snowflake is no different, it is also designed and developed for certain use cases. For example, it not an OLTP engine and should not be used for transactional workloads. Let us see why it would not be a good choice for an OLTP application. Snowflake stores data in contiguous units of storage called micro-partitions.

Which schema is faster star or snowflake?

The Star schema is in a more de-normalized form and hence tends to be better for performance. Along the same lines the Star schema uses less foreign keys so the query execution time is limited. In almost all cases the data retrieval speed of a Star schema has the Snowflake beat.

Is Snowflake part of AWS?

To support today’s data analytics, companies need a data platform. … Snowflake Cloud Data Platform on Amazon Web Services (AWS) represents a SQL data warehouse that requires near-zero management, and combines all your data, all your users, allows data sharing and you pay for only what you use.

What is Snowflake AWS?

Snowflake enables the data-driven enterprise with instant elasticity, secure data sharing, and per-second pricing. Its built-for-the-cloud architecture combines the power of data warehousing, the flexibility of big data platforms, and the elasticity of the cloud.

Who is using snowflake?

Companies Currently Using Snowflake Data WarehouseCompany NameWebsitePhoneTableau Softwaretableau.com(206) 633-3400Travelerstravelers.com(888) 695-4640Capital Onecapitalone.com(877) 383-4802Discover Financial Servicesdiscover.com(801) 902-31002 more rows

What is snowflake schema explain?

In computing, a snowflake schema is a logical arrangement of tables in a multidimensional database such that the entity relationship diagram resembles a snowflake shape. The snowflake schema is represented by centralized fact tables which are connected to multiple dimensions..

Snowflake can deliver results so quickly because it’s a hybrid of traditional shared-disk database and shared-nothing database architectures. Just like the shared-disk database, it uses a central repository accessible from all compute nodes for persisted data.

What is Snowflake used for?

Snowflake is a cloud-based Data Warehouse solution provided as a Saas (Software-as-a-Service) with full support for ANSI SQL. It also has a unique architecture that enables users to just create tables and start querying data with very less administration or DBA activities needed.

Is Snowflake a Rdbms?

What Makes Snowflake a Data Warehouse? … At Snowflake, in part, we say we are a full relational database management system (RDBMS) built for the cloud. We are ACID compliant and we support standard SQL.

What are the advantages of snowflake schema?

There are two main advantages to the snowflake schema: Better data quality (data is more structured, so data integrity problems are reduced) Less disk space is used then in a denormalized model.

Is Snowflake on AWS?

Snowflake is a cloud data warehouse built on top of the Amazon Web Services (AWS) cloud infrastructure and is a true SaaS offering. There is no hardware (virtual or physical) for you to select, install, configure, or manage. There is no software for you to install, configure, or manage.

What is the difference between Snowflake and star schema?

Star and snowflake schemas are similar at heart: a central fact table surrounded by dimension tables. The difference is in the dimensions themselves. In a star schema each logical dimension is denormalized into one table, while in a snowflake, at least some of the dimensions are normalized.

Is Snowflake an ETL tool?

ETL for Snowflake: An Overview Essentially, Snowflake ETL is a 3-step process which includes: Extracting data from a source and creating data files. The data files could be CSV, JSON, Parquet, XML, and several other formats as well as a mixture of several formats.

Is Snowflake SaaS or PAAS?

Snowflake is an analytic data warehouse provided as Software-as-a-Service (SaaS). Snowflake provides a data warehouse that is faster, easier to use, and far more flexible than traditional data warehouse offerings.